PFN Inc. has recently determined that its northern strip mining operation will only be profitable for 10 more years, and the company anticipates that it will need $5 million at that time to fill and refresh damaged land. To ensure that sufficient funds are available, PFN has decided to set aside a certain amount of cash twice per year in a sinking fund on which it estimates it can earn an effective annual interest rate of 9%.

REQUIRED:

Problem a) Calculate how much PFN must deposit each semi-annual period if it is to have the $5 million at the end of 10 years. (Assume deposits are made at the end of each semi-annual period.) (Timeline not required.)

Problem b) If, at the end of 5 years, immediately after making its tenth semi-annual deposit, the firm decides to make a lump sum deposit in lieu of further sinking fund payments, how large a lump sum would be required? (Timeline not required.)
